    Rules and Conditions

    1. Large-scale industrial producers, importers, and OEM products over 100,000 liters per year. Registration fee 5,500 THB/Entry

    2. Small producers and importers of up to 100,000 liters per year. Registration fee 3,500 THB/Entry

    1. Eligibility of contestants

    • Breweries, whether individuals or beer company, both in Thailand and abroad.
    • Must be operators who have a legally valid beer production license in the country of establishment or have a legally valid import license for beer products in the country of establishment.
    • ​In case of the applicant is not the owner of the products, TIBA reserves the right to disclaim responsibility for any disputes arising between the applicant and the owner of the brand, trademark and ownership rights. Responsibility rests with the applicant.

    2. Eligibility of the entries

    • Entries must be produced by a brewery that is legally licensed to operate, in accordance with the eligibility criteria for contestants.
    • Entries must comply with the laws and regulations of the country of production, including proper tax payment.
    • Entries must be of quality and standards suitable for consumption and must not be harmful to consumers.

    3. Types and categories of entries.

    • Applicant can submit works in any group of style, and can submit only 2 beers per group style.
    • The submitted works must clearly specify the category and type.

    4. Submission of works for the contest.

    • Fill out the online registration form only through the official channels of TIBA.
    • The submitted works must have the quantity and packaging format as specified by the committee.
    • Bottles or cans of size 330 - 350 ml, 6 units (units of packaging).
    • Bottles or cans of size 500 - 640 ml, 4 units (units of packaging).
    • Download the label print and patch it to each piece of packaging with waterproof stickers.
    • Wrap packaging with separate cushioning materials
    • Pack 4 or 6 units of packaging into 1 plastic bag per work.
    • Pack into boxes and fill all gaps inside the boxes with cushioning materials
    • Contestants must submit their works to the designated submission location within the specified time.

    5. Qualification verification.

    • The TIBA committee has the right to verify the qualifications of contestants and works to ensure compliance with laws and regulations.
    • If it is found that the applicant or the work does not meet the specified conditions, the committee has the right to disqualify the entry without prior notice.
    • No registration fees can be refunded under any circumstances.

    Judging Principles

    • Judging will be conducted by a panel of experts from both domestic and international backgrounds.
    • Judging will be conducted according to the BJCP Guidelines 2021.

    Judging Process

    • The judging panel consists of judges certified by BJCP (Beer Judge Certification Program)
    • or have experience in judging beer according to BJCP standards.
    • Each entry will be evaluated by at least 3-5 judges to ensure accurate and impartial results.
    • Judges will use the BJCP Scoresheet to record scores for the participants.
    • Participants will receive their Scoresheet within 1 month after the award announcement.

    Award Announcement

    • Entries that score above the threshold in each category will receive a certificate and medals at the Gold, Silver, and Bronze levels respectively.
    • If any entry scores below the minimum threshold, it may not receive any awards.
    • The results from TIBA are final and cannot be changed.

    Objective

    1

    Promoting standards and quality in craft beer production.

    To elevate the quality and production standards of craft beer both of Thailand and international with an emphasis on expert evaluation according to international standards. 

    2

    Build networks and collaborations within the industry.

    To connecting brewers, academics, experts, and consumers both domestic and international, promoting the exchange of knowledge, aesthetics, and credibility, which will benefit producers and the craft beer industry in Thailand. 

    3

    A platform for recognizing achievements and inspiring.

    To recognize and reward outstanding brewery and inspire those interested in entering Thailand's craft beer industry. 

    4

    Raising awareness about craft beer.

    To help consumers understand and appreciate the diversity of craft beers, as well as the culture of responsible drinking.
